Troubleshooting Common Issues with Hunter ICM Modules resolving

When dealing with Hunter ICM modules, you may encounter a variety of common issues that can disrupt system functionality. Inspecting your wiring connections is always the first step. Ensure that all wires are securely connected and free from wear. Next, review your module's settings to make sure they are correctly configured for your specific application. Typical problems include malfunctioning solenoids, faulty controllers, or interference with the signal.

  • Troubleshooting these issues often involves using a multimeter to check voltage and current flow. You can also refer to the Hunter ICM module's user manual for guidance.
